比特币私匙几位数 比特币密钥是几位数
比特币作为第一个成功的加密货币,其安全性根植于密码学原理,而私钥则是这一体系的核心。私钥本质上是一个256位的随机数,通常以64位十六进制字符串的形式呈现,例如`1A2b3C...`(共64字符)。这种设计不仅保证了资产的唯一控制权,还通过加密算法(如椭圆曲线数字签名算法,ECDSA)将私钥与公钥及比特币地址关联起来,形成一个不可逆的推导链条。在比特币网络中,私钥的字符长度和随机性共同构成了其强大的安全基础,使得暴力破解或反向推导在实践中几乎不可行。
私钥的64字符十六进制格式源自其256位的二进制本质。每个十六进制字符对应4位二进制数(如“A”表示二进制1010),因此64字符×4位/字符=256位。这种表示法不仅便于计算机处理,还确保了私钥的紧凑性和可操作性。从技术演进看,比特币的创造者中本聪在2008年白皮书中首次提出这一概念,旨在实现一个去中心化的支付系统,其中私钥作为用户自主控制的终极凭证。历史上,比特币的兴起伴随着对私钥重要性的深入认知——例如,早期用户因丢失私钥而永久失去资产的案例屡见不鲜,这进一步凸显了其字符构成的严肃性。
私钥的字符构成与技术细节
比特币私钥的64字符十六进制字符串具有以下关键特征:
- 字符范围:包括数字0-9和字母A-F(不区分大小写,但通常以小写或大写统一表示),例如`e3b0c44298fc1c14...`。
- 二进制等价性:256位的长度相当于2种可能的组合,这一数字极大(约10),远超宇宙中原子总数的量级,从而确保了私钥的不可猜测性。
- 生成机制:私钥通过加密学安全的随机数生成器(CSPRNG)产生,确保每个私钥都是唯一的。这个过程类似于抛硬币256次,将结果转换为十六进制格式,突出了其随机性和公平性。
为了更直观地理解私钥的构成,以下表格对比了私钥与相关元素的字符特性:
| 元素 | 字符数 | 格式 | 功能描述 |
|---|---|---|---|
| 私钥 | 64字符 | 十六进制字符串 | 控制比特币地址中的资产,用于生成数字签名,证明所有权 |
| 公钥 | 130字符(未压缩)或66字符(压缩) | 十六进制字符串 | 由私钥推导而来,用于验证交易签名,但不直接暴露资产细节 |
| 比特币地址 | 26-35字符 | Base58编码 | 由公钥哈希生成,作为公开的接收标识,无法反向推导私钥 |
私钥的64字符长度并非偶然,而是密码学需求与实用性的平衡。首先,256位的安全性足以抵抗当前的计算攻击——例如,使用超级计算机暴力破解私钥需耗时数亿年,这使得比特币网络在理论上极为稳健。其次,这种格式与区块链的分布式账本结构协同工作:每一笔交易都需要私钥签名,而签名过程依赖于私钥的完整字符序列,确保交易的真实性和不可篡改性。从比特币发展史看,私钥的构成也反映了其去中心化哲学。正如早期采用者所述,用私钥掌握比特币的人不仅展现了财力,更体现了对密码学、经济学和自学能力的掌握,这使他们成为数字时代的精英代表。
私钥的安全性与管理实践
比特币私钥的安全性直接决定了资产的保护水平。其64字符的构成通过加密算法(如SHA-256和RIPEMD-160)转化为公钥和地址,但反向推导私钥从地址或公钥在数学上不可行,这得益于椭圆曲线加密的非对称特性。例如,即使攻击者获得了某个比特币地址,他们也无法通过公钥反推出私钥,因为算法设计确保了“单向性”。然而,这种安全性也带来了管理挑战:私钥一旦丢失或遗忘,相关资产可能永久无法找回。统计显示,截至2025年,已有数百万比特币因私钥管理不当而沉睡在链上,这警示用户必须采取严格的备份措施。
在实际应用中,私钥的64字符长度要求用户采用高效的管理策略。以下是常见的保护方法:
1.备份私钥和助记词:助记词通常由12-24个单词组成,作为私钥的另一种表示形式,便于记忆和存储;建议将备份写在纸上或存储在加密设备中,避免数字风险。
2.使用硬件钱包:硬件钱包(如Ledger或Trezor)将私钥离线保存,有效防御网络攻击和恶意软件,同时兼容64字符的原始格式。
3.定期检查与更新:确保钱包软件处于最新版本,以应对潜在漏洞,同时验证私钥的完整性。
从区块链发展视角看,私钥的字符构成不仅是一个技术问题,更承载着信任与责任的哲学。比特币网络无中央控制者,私钥成为用户主权的象征。正如有观点指出,用私钥掌握比特币的人往往具备超强的自学能力和独立思考习惯,这使他们能够在波动市场中保持冷静,深谙价值投资之道。这种特性在比特币的演进中不断强化——例如,第一次比特币交易(2010年用1万比特币购买披萨)就依赖于私钥的有效签名,而今这已成为加密货币文化的经典叙事。
私钥的常见问题与未来展望
尽管比特币私钥的64字符设计已高度成熟,但随着区块链技术的演进,其应用场景不断扩展。例如,智能合约和去中心化金融(DeFi)项目同样依赖于私钥机制,强调字符长度与安全性的平衡。未来,量子计算等新兴技术可能对256位加密构成挑战,但比特币社区已开始探索后量子密码学方案,以确保私钥的长期稳健性。
FAQ
1.比特币私钥为什么是64位字符?
私钥本质上是256位二进制数,而每个十六进制字符表示4位,因此64字符(64×4=256位)是其自然等价形式,旨在实现高安全性和易处理性。
2.私钥的字符数是否可变?
否,比特币协议固定私钥为256位,对应64十六进制字符;任何偏差都会导致无效私钥,无法控制资产。
3.丢失私钥后如何找回比特币?
如果未备份,私钥几乎无法找回;但若使用支持助记词或备份功能的钱包,可通过预设流程恢复,但成功率取决于提前设置。
4.私钥和公钥在字符数上有何区别?
私钥固定为64字符(十六进制),而公钥通常为66或130字符(取决于压缩格式),两者通过加密算法关联。
5.暴力破解一个比特币私钥需要多久?
理论上,需尝试2次,以当前算力估算需数亿年,因此实践中不可行。
6.一个私钥可以存储多少比特币?
私钥本身不限制存储量,其关联的比特币地址可容纳任意数量比特币,但安全风险随资产价值增加而上升。
7.私钥的字符是否区分大小写?
在十六进制表示中,通常不区分,但实际使用时建议保持一致以避免混淆。
8.硬件钱包如何保护64字符私钥?
它将私钥存储在隔离的芯片中,交易签名在设备内完成,私钥永不暴露于联网环境,从而抵御攻击。
9.私钥生成过程中如何确保随机性?
必须使用加密学安全的随机源(如硬件随机数生成器),避免伪随机方法,以防预测风险。
10.比特币私钥的字符构成会随协议升级改变吗?
目前无此类计划;任何修改需全球共识,以免破坏网络兼容性和信任基础。
-
芝麻开门交易所官方下载最新版 芝麻交易 11-09